Case Studies of Major Military Airlift Missions

Major military airlift missions illustrate the strategic importance and operational capabilities of military airlift operations. One notable example is Operation Desert Shield and Desert Storm, where the U.S. Air Force deployed over 100,000 troops and vast quantities of equipment across continents within weeks, highlighting global reach and logistical efficiency.

Similarly, the NATO-led Kosovo Force (KFOR) mission demonstrated the role of strategic lift in peacekeeping, successfully transporting personnel, humanitarian aid, and equipment to destabilized regions. These missions relied heavily on advanced aircraft fleets, such as the C-17 Globemaster III, capable of rapid deployment over long distances with heavy payloads.

Another significant case involved the deployment of the U.S. military during humanitarian relief efforts following the 2010 Haiti earthquake. Strategic airlift capabilities enabled the rapid delivery of aid and personnel, restoring vital supplies in a disaster zone far from U.S. bases.

These case studies exemplify how military airlift operations extend global reach, enabling rapid response and enhanced operational effectiveness in diverse scenarios worldwide. They underscore the vital role of strategic lift in modern military operations and global security.

Challenges to Maintaining Global Reach

Maintaining the global reach of military airlift operations faces several significant challenges. Environmental factors such as adverse weather conditions and natural disasters can disrupt deployment schedules and limit aircraft availability. Logistics complexities, including coordinating diverse transportation networks across different regions, often hinder timely operations.

Budget constraints and resource allocation also impact strategic lift capabilities, restricting fleet expansion and maintenance, which are essential for extended missions. In addition, geopolitical tensions and regional conflicts can restrict access to certain airspaces or bases, complicating deployment routes.

Other challenges include technological limitations, such as aircraft range and payload capacity, which may not meet evolving operational demands. Security concerns, including threats from hostile forces or cybersecurity risks to logistical systems, further complicate maintaining uninterrupted global reach.

Addressing these challenges requires continuous innovation, strategic planning, and international cooperation to sustain, enhance, and adapt military airlift capabilities for global operations.

Emerging Technologies and Aircraft Developments

Emerging technologies and aircraft developments significantly enhance the capabilities of military airlift operations, enabling better support for strategic lift and expanding global reach. Recent innovations focus on increasing aircraft efficiency, speed, and payload capacities to meet operational demands.

Advanced materials like composite structures reduce aircraft weight, allowing for larger payloads without compromising fuel efficiency. Additionally, the integration of next-generation propulsion systems, such as more powerful and fuel-efficient engines, further extends operational ranges.

Several technological advancements are reshaping the landscape of military airlift capabilities, including:

  1. Unmanned aerial systems (UAS): Expanded use for logistics and reconnaissance missions.
  2. Hybrid-electric propulsion: Potentially revolutionizes long-distance flights with reduced fuel consumption.
  3. Enhanced avionics and automation: Improve safety, reduce crews needed, and streamline missions.

Despite continuous progress, some emerging technologies remain under development, and their full operational impact is yet to be determined. Ultimately, these developments promise to reinforce the strategic lift capabilities that underpin the global reach of military airlift operations.
